Abstract

This utility model relates to a medical electronic device and its port structure, including a port base disposed on the outer wall of the device housing and a matching port cover. The port base is provided with a groove, a magnetic suction element and a socket. The port cover is vertically attracted to the base by the magnetic suction element to achieve quick opening and closing. The anti-detachment unit adopts a limiting hole and a flexible connector to prevent the port cover from being lost. The protrusion of the flexible connector slides and limits the position within the limiting hole. This design solves the problems of easy loss and inconvenient operation of traditional port covers and is suitable for medical environments with high-frequency sterilization.

[0001] This invention relates to the field of medical electronic equipment technology, and specifically to a medical electronic equipment port and its port cover having an anti-loss, easy-to-operate magnetic structure. Background Technology

[0002] In the medical industry, the reliability, ease of use, and safety of equipment are directly related to patients' lives and health. Especially in environments such as hospitals, operating rooms, and treatment rooms, the port structure, as one of the core control components of medical equipment, not only needs to possess basic functionality but must also meet stringent hygiene and contamination prevention requirements. These devices are frequently exposed to high bacterial loads, high humidity, and frequent cleaning and disinfection operations. Any improper design can lead to equipment malfunction or bacterial growth, thereby affecting patient health and safety. The hygiene and contamination prevention design of push-button switches, input / output interfaces, and ventilation vents in medical equipment requires designers to consider multiple aspects, including material selection, structural design, waterproofing and dustproofing, and antibacterial disinfection, to ensure that push-button switches can operate stably and persistently in harsh medical environments.

[0003] Existing detachable port covers are prone to loss during high-frequency operation, exposing the ports to contaminated environments containing disinfectants, blood, etc., leading to equipment malfunctions or cross-infection. Traditional rotary / snap-on port covers require two-handed operation, delaying action in emergency rescue scenarios. Utility Model Content

[0026] Existing medical electronic equipment ports often use a separate port cover 2, and the port cover 2 and the port base 1 are connected by a snap-fit ​​structure. This not only makes it easy for the port cover 2 to be lost, but also requires two hands to open and close, and the sealing is not good, which can easily cause cross-infection.

[0027] Based on the aforementioned issues, please refer to Figures 1 and 2. This embodiment provides a port structure for medical electronic devices. The port structure includes a port base 1 disposed on the outer wall of the electronic device housing and a port cover 2 adapted to the port base 1. The port base 1 includes a groove 11, one or more first magnetic attractors 12 disposed in the groove 11, and one or more insertion ports 13 disposed in the groove 11. The insertion ports 13 are for inserting corresponding connectors. The port cover 2 includes a cover body 21 covering the groove 11 and one or more second magnetic attractors 22 disposed on the cover body 21. Each second magnetic attractor 22 is opposite to and magnetically connected to the corresponding first magnetic attractor 12 along a magnetic attraction direction perpendicular to the cover surface. Please refer to Figures 3 and 4. By providing the first magnetic attractor 12 in the groove 11 of the port base 1, and the first magnetic attractor 12 in the cover body 21 of the port cover 2, the first magnetic attractor 12 is provided in the groove 11 of the port base 1. A second magnetic clasp 22 is provided, and the two are magnetically connected along a magnetic direction perpendicular to the cover surface, enabling quick opening and closing of the port cover 2 and the port base 1. Compared to the traditional snap-fit ​​structure, the opening and closing action can be completed with one hand.

[0028] Furthermore, an anti-detachment unit is provided between the port cover 2 and the port base 1 to prevent complete separation between the two. This anti-detachment design ensures that the port cover 2 remains connected to the device at all times, significantly reducing maintenance costs and contamination risks due to loss. In some embodiments, the anti-detachment unit includes a flexible connector 4, with one end of the flexible connector 4 disposed on the port cover 2 and the other end disposed on the port base 1. This structure is simple and low-cost. The flexible connector 4 has a certain degree of flexibility, which neither affects the normal opening and closing angle of the port cover 2 nor fails to reliably prevent separation between the two.

[0029] In some specific examples, the anti-detachment unit includes a limiting hole 14 disposed in the groove 11 and a flexible connector 4 fixedly connected to the port cover 2; the flexible connector 4 has an extension section and a free end, the extension section extending from the cover 21 toward the limiting hole 14, and the free end forming a protrusion 41. The extension section is slidably inserted into the limiting hole 14, and the protrusion 41 is located on the side of the port base 1 away from the port cover 2, and is axially limited with the limiting hole 14. When the port cover 2 is subjected to a pulling force away from the port base 1, the axial limiting effect of the protrusion 41 and the limiting hole 14 can effectively prevent complete detachment, and the extension section of the flexible connector 4 can be slidably inserted into the limiting hole 14, allowing the port cover 2 to open to a sufficient angle to fully expose the socket 13 without affecting the insertion and removal operation of the connector. In addition, the protrusion 41 is located inside the port base 1, which does not occupy external space, making the appearance of the device simpler and avoiding damage to the limiting structure from external collisions, thus improving the durability of the structure.

[0030] The flexible connector 4 can take the form of, but is not limited to, silicone strips or connecting ropes. In this embodiment, the flexible connector 4 is a silicone strip, with the free end of the silicone strip forming a protrusion such as a mushroom head or a T-shaped block. The limiting hole 14 is a horizontally extending strip-shaped hole. Thus, when opened: the port cover 2 is lifted, the extension slides within the limiting hole 14, and the protrusion 41 moves accordingly but is limited by the strip-shaped hole; when the port cover 2 is excessively stretched, the protrusion 41 abuts against the inner wall of the limiting hole 14, preventing complete detachment.

[0031] In some embodiments of this utility model, the groove 11 and the cover 21 are provided with one or more mounting holes, the inner wall of the mounting hole forms a stepped surface, the first magnetic suction member 12 and the second magnetic suction member 22 are disposed in the mounting hole and form an axial stop with the stepped surface, which can effectively prevent the magnetic suction member from axially loosening or falling off during long-term magnetic attraction and opening and closing, and ensure the stability of the magnetic attraction connection.

[0032] In some embodiments of this utility model, the port cover 2 is a flexible component, and the first magnetic absorbing component 12 and the second magnetic absorbing component 22 are fixed in the groove 11 and the cover body 21 respectively by embedding, in-mold injection molding, or welding. For the port cover 2 made of flexible material, these fixing methods can form a tight bond with the flexible substrate: the embedding method can use the micro-elasticity of the flexible material to wrap the magnetic absorbing component and prevent loosening; in-mold injection molding can make the magnetic absorbing component integrated with the cover body 21 and the groove 11, eliminating gaps and reducing the risk of liquid and dust intrusion; welding, through molecular fusion between materials, makes the magnetic absorbing component firmly connected to the flexible substrate, and can maintain structural stability even under frequent opening and closing or disinfection and wiping operations, which not only meets the requirements of medical environment for equipment sealing and durability, but also does not affect the flexibility and magnetic attraction effect of the port cover 2. In addition, adhesive bonding can also be used.

[0033] Optionally, the flexible connector 4 is made of elastic silicone or TPU material, and its length is configured to allow the port cover 2 to be flipped up to the maximum opening angle relative to the port base 1, so that the socket 13 is fully exposed. Alternatively, the magnet can be modified in shape, not limited to a circle. In addition to a circle, a square magnet can also be used. During installation, a square magnet can better fit with a rectangular mounting hole, reducing shaking and improving the stability of the connection, making it suitable for scenarios with high installation accuracy requirements. An elliptical magnet has better guiding properties, enabling smoother alignment during the docking of the port cover 2 and the port base 1, making it particularly suitable for use in situations where space is limited or the operating angle is not ideal.

[0034] Furthermore, in this embodiment, the first magnetic attractor 12 and the second magnetic attractor 22 use the same type of magnet.

[0035] In some embodiments of this utility model, the first magnetic absorbing element 12 and the second magnetic absorbing element 22 have a T-shaped cross-section, including a large-diameter end and a small-diameter end. After the small end of the T-shape is embedded in the mounting hole of the flexible cover 21 / base 1, the large end forms a mechanical stop with the stepped surface. Combined with in-mold injection molding or adhesive bonding processes, the loosening of the magnetic absorbing element is completely prevented. When the port cover 2 is closed, the large-diameter end of the first magnetic absorbing element 12 and the small-diameter end of the second magnetic absorbing element 22 are positioned opposite each other along the magnetic attraction direction. By positioning the large-diameter end of the first magnetic absorbing element 12 and the small-diameter end of the second magnetic absorbing element 22 opposite each other, the magnetic attraction force is concentrated in the central area, forming a stronger magnetic attraction effect.

[0036] The large-diameter end of the first magnetic suction member 12 is positioned facing the inside of the equipment housing, and the large-diameter end of the second magnetic suction member 22 is positioned facing the outside of the cover 21. The large end faces the non-exposed side, which reduces the direct contact of disinfectant with the magnetic seam and reduces the risk of corrosion.

[0037] For example, the port base 1 provided here has two data ports 13, and two mounting slots are formed on the side of the port base 1 away from the cover 21 for mounting circuit boards.
